Abstract
A system and method for optimizing a multimedia transmission from a content source to an end user over a link. The wireless content switch comprising an upstream port for receiving one or more data packets and for transmitting one or more status to a content source, a downstream port for transmitting the one or more data packets and for receiving one or more status from an end user, at least one processing unit coupled to the upstream and down stream ports, and memory for storing the one or more data packets responsive to receiving the data packets. Optimization code is stored in the memory, the optimization code, when executed, receiving at least one data packet, transmitting the data packet, receiving status information, transmitting status information, determining quality of service assigned to the end user, determining session specific status for the end user, and transmitting the quality of service and session specific status.
